C14 Radiocarbon Dating - Sample - AA-25230
AA-25230
NE Passage Grave. A piece of birch charcoal from one of three samples (S.6 - 8) from a small cutting inside the kerb of the north-east cairn, taken from the material of the core cairn, covered by rubble of the upper part of the cairn. Micromorphological analysis suggests that this consists of redeposited turf from the burning of the site before construction of the cairn.
